&lt;DIV&gt;The Double Bearing Brushless 8.2kw,&amp;nbsp; ,&amp;nbsp; weighs 209 lbs &lt;BR&gt;The Double Bearing Brushless 13.5kw, &amp;nbsp; weighs 242 lbs. &lt;BR&gt;The Double Bearing Brushless 24kw ,&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; weighs 286 lbs.&lt;BR&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;BR&gt;You Must Add Your Prime Mover (motor) to these alternators and&lt;BR&gt;the formula for torque is:&amp;nbsp; kw/rpm*9550 = torque in NM*.736 = torque in ft lbs.&lt;BR&gt;Starting torque is &amp;lt; 1/10 the full load torque.&lt;/DIV&gt;
&lt;DIV&gt;&lt;BR&gt;Example:&amp;nbsp; &lt;BR&gt;8.2kw/1800 rpm =.0045555*9550 =43.505 NM*.736 =32.01 ft lbs of torque.&amp;nbsp; &lt;/DIV&gt;
&lt;DIV&gt;Starting torque will be less than 3.2 ft lbs.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;Best way to determine what Horse Power engine that will be&amp;nbsp;required, &lt;BR&gt;for a diesel 1800 rpm engine is , to take the&amp;nbsp;wattage rating of the&amp;nbsp;generator and &lt;BR&gt;divide that by 700&lt;BR&gt;Example:&amp;nbsp; 8200/700 =11.71 hp or you need a 12hp engine&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;Conversly For hi speed gas engines and diesel coupled to generator units&amp;nbsp;operating at 3600 rpm&amp;nbsp;,&amp;nbsp; the rule of thumb is 2 HP per kw.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;&lt;FONT size=5&gt;&lt;SPAN style="TEXT-DECORATION: underline"&gt;This Is The Brush Type (ST) Alternator/Generator Close Up&lt;BR&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/STRONG&gt;Notice These Units Come With A Shaft That Can Be Belt Or Shaft Connected&lt;BR&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;&lt;EM&gt;&lt;FONT size=6&gt;&lt;IMG src="http://images.quickblogcast.com/85977-75155/P1010332.JPG?a=44"&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;FONT size=5&gt;&lt;SPAN style="TEXT-DECORATION: underline"&gt;This Is&amp;nbsp;A Brushless Type&amp;nbsp;Single Bearing Close Up&lt;BR&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;Notice These Come With A Coupler Plate&amp;nbsp;Designed Directly Bolt To An Engine. &l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=3&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;We get calls from companies &amp;amp; individuals alike, both looking to buy inexpensive land where they can build their new self sustainable building. Unfortunately, most places have building codes that are overly restrictive and make it difficult to build with alternative materials such as Rammed Earth , Adobe Blocks , Concrete Domes, etc or even to be off grid without any public utilities. But within some states in North America, we still have counties that don't require building permits nor building inspections what so ever. While these locations are not in downtown areas and are typically in more remote, rural areas, they are normally within the modern driving range of most metropolitan areas so , the job you may still have or wish to get , can still be gotten to.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;A few&amp;nbsp;locations&amp;nbsp;currently do have building codes, that include Adobe &amp;amp; Rammed Earth Construction &amp;amp; You Can Find A Copy Of Those Codes, &amp;nbsp;At Our Georgia Adobe Yahoo Group Links Page. See The Contact Us Section Above , For A Link To The Groups. You may be able to use this existing code&amp;nbsp;as part of your argument to allow your use as well in your area. Also ASTM has just released a study of required mixtures to get to a load bearing strength for Earthen Construction mixes. They charge about $38 for their report and you must purchase this,&amp;nbsp;from&amp;nbsp;ASTM directly. Search For: &amp;nbsp;ASTM Earthen Construction Minimum Standards 2010.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;EM&gt;&lt;SPAN style="TEXT-DECORATION: underline"&gt;YOUR HELP IS NEEDED !&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/EM&gt;&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;FONT size=5&gt;Adobe&amp;nbsp;is a&amp;nbsp;Earthen material block. Adobe&amp;nbsp;Construction&lt;/FONT&gt; is said to be mans 2nd oldest profession. Some say, Gods &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;Greatest Gift To Man, was the Earth as without it , we would be a drift at best. We &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;agree&amp;nbsp;with&amp;nbsp;that and thinks also , with this wonderful material, we can design &amp;amp; build a new building &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;for your business or large residential needs.&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;As that our company normally only works for Commercial clients or for larger&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;residential projects we offer the below Free information to those of you&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;interested in hiring us to design &amp;amp; build for you and also for those persons&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;doing it yourself, to build a average size, family home. Personally, We don't&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;think you can find a better material to choose than Earth to build with !&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;Adobe blocks are strong, can be designed to have openings&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;within them to pour with cement and rebar when needed , they are as light weight&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;as common cement blocks &amp;amp; they are portable. With the knowledge of a skilled&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;professional mason, the floors , the walls, the fireplace and the Roof can be&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;made from adobe blocks and the same earthen mixes , can provide a stucco&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;coating inside &amp;amp; out and the very mortar mix binding the blocks together,&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;achieving a high degree of sustainability.&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;　&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;　&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;The ease of construction starts with simple materials sometimes right under your&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;feet. Sand, Clay and some finely chopped Straw. at a 70% sand 29.5% clay and .5%&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;chopped straw mix one will find the traditional basic mixture, to build a block&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;with. The straw adds to the quality to the mix, in that it helps hold the block&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;together, in a non-fired block and in a fired block , one get little chimneys to&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;develop as heat within the block, flows where straw burns out . This makes the&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;block stronger or less likely to crack.&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;The clay acts like Portland Cement does, in that it is microscopically , a plate&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;like substance, that binds the Sand together, in a lightly compacted earthen&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;mix. The clay can be replaced in part with Portland, if one wishes a water resistant block &amp;amp; a&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;5% to 6% replacement, is what one sees in use. Hydrated Lime can also be used&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;but, the lime is normally required at twice the quantity, of Portland Cement.&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;The Block form is only designed to be temporally used to define the blocks size&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;and it is 4 sided, thus keeping the width &amp;amp; length constant while allowing the&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;removal &amp;amp; reuse of the same form to make additional blocks, in a semi continuous&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;manner . The form makes l block at a time and you will need many blocks to&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;construct a building with. The drying time varies with the weather and water&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;content you start with but 30 days in warm - dry weather is a common time frame&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;to have finished blocks.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;4 inches thick 8 x 16 or 12 x 12 &amp;amp; some 12 x 16 inch blocks are common. To&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;fabricate holes just add a spacer where desired, One then lays the blocks with&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;or without mortar , sometimes placing the small ends running outside to inside ,&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;to give a thicker wall. Always keep your earthen blocks off the ground with a&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;stem wall of at least 6 inches , pour solid cement headers &amp;amp; place them or use&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;wooden beams with mortar to set them as well. Leave some nail blocks embedded ,&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;where you want to add wood work to the walls and at the top of your wall you&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;will want a solid concrete bond beam tying all together. For the roof made with&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;blocks see the drawing we include in the photos section as it details the old&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;world practice of arch roof construction.&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;What Is The Way We Think Most Walls Should Be Built ?&lt;BR&gt;&amp;nbsp; 2 Words&amp;nbsp; :&lt;BR&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;RAMMED EARTH !&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;This is by far the best process for developing any earthen constructed structure. Why you may ask ? Because we believe , it is the most solid and if done our way hardly any code out there will turn down this design of building as it mimics the standard concrete construction already in place today. &l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;If You Want A Modern Structure Built With Ancient Materials While Building Economically AND Without Debt : THIS IS IT:&lt;BR&gt;Rammed Earth.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;We are building with a natural concrete a product called Rammed Earth. It has many use possibilities but the easiest to understand is the post and beam design.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/B&gt;&lt;/I&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t;Think of this method as the &lt;B&gt;&lt;I&gt;&lt;FONT face=Georgia&gt;&lt;FONT face=Georgia&gt;post and beam construction process we all learned about in wood construction but, without the standard wooden post and or beams -&lt;/B&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/I&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;FONT size=4&gt; And built with materials that would perhaps outlast wood.&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;For the smoothest looking walls without too many form lift marks, brought about by moving up your forms, the entire wall section is to be formed all at once. The Earthcrete (TM) is packed all the way to the top in 3 to 6 inch lifts &amp;amp; then the forms are used over again on the next section. &l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;Tamping with long poles , weighted by heavy ends attached&amp;nbsp;into tall frames ( as high as the wall ) &amp;nbsp;, using a bit less intensive compaction , than short framed work will achieve, a more seamless appearance when finished, as you add more&amp;nbsp;Earth to your forms. &lt;BR&gt;It must be firm but each layer added, adds to that firmness as you work. The thickness of the wall is determined by the loads that will be placed upon that wall. We normally install 24 inch thick walls for single story structures and a structural engineer always makes the call of what is required as sometimes less thickness is all that is needed. The mixture of Earth added to your wall, will help them make this call .&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;IMG src="http://images.quickblogcast.com/85977-75155/img181.gif?a=62"&gt;&amp;nbsp;A key way, is formed in the 2 end sections of the wall forms, by the addition of perhaps a 6" board standing from bottom to top, at each end. This ties the two wall sections together later, as a concrete or Earthcrete (TM) post is poured in place, between the 2 finished Rammed Earth walls . This post then ties &amp;amp; connects all sections , to the very top bond beam , of concrete steel or wood. This is where the older wooden post and beam is alike the Rammed Earth post &amp;amp; beam method. It ties the wall sections together with the roof in a method that is a age old proven method. New Mexico for example, has in their building codes as section on Earthen construction specifying vertical support at 25 foot increments. This might be a tee wall or a buttress intersection or simply the end of the wall at a right angle. &l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;&lt;EM&gt;&lt;SPAN style="TEXT-DECORATION: underline"&gt;E=MC2&lt;/SPAN&gt;&amp;nbsp; Remember that one ? Greater Mass means Greater Strength And Greter Thermal Mass Too !&lt;/EM&gt;&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;BR&gt;&lt;BR&gt;Concrete makes the strongest walls &amp;amp; concrete post , as your vertical structural element is still&amp;nbsp;finished as&amp;nbsp;a Rammed Earth wall would be. One might also add color to the concrete mix during the pour or afterwards. &amp;nbsp;Thermal mass is still the end result and the flywheel effect of temperature control is still received . Wooden post set in the ground and tied into the earth walls could also be in keeping with older historical methods of additional stabilization but, that predates concrete and though wooden post have lasted a long time they might fall victim to the ravages of Pest or Rot over Time therefore we like concrete post best. &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
